Responsibilities:
  • Oversee detailed structural design production and development, from concept through to completion, ensuring alignment with UK industry standards, and key regulations.
  • Create, develop, and review drawings, structural elements and components, and sketches for a range of multidisciplinary projects.
  • Liaise with CAD technicians and professionals, ensuring the production and development of precise drawings, in line with client requirements.
  • Ensure the implementation of current structural engineering regulations, codes, and principles, whilst collating project data through in-depth research.
  • Work alongside multidisciplinary teams, ensuring effective and transparent communication, whilst ensuring professional representation is maintained.
  • Assemble relevant information and data to present to clients and key stakeholders, whilst conducting administrative activities and performance reviews.
Requirements:
  • Bachelor's degree, or higher, in Structural or Civil Engineering, or a related discipline, with an attained chartered status, or actively working towards one.
  • 7+ years of experience as a Structural Engineer, or a similar position, working within a consultancy environment, with an understanding of relevant processes and techniques.
  • Significant technical background, with an understanding of relevant software tools, such as Tekla, ETABS, BIM platforms (Revit, Navisworks and ACC), and Microsoft Office.
  • Extensive experience with seismic design production, steel structures, and the production of detailed drawings for a range of projects, ideally EMEA.
  • Strong and effective communication skills, with an ability to build and maintain rapport with project teams, and a willingness to travel across the UK and internationally
